consulting yaml solution architecture android studio elasticsearch automation mysql agile software development agile central android (operating system) dynatrace infrastructure pandas computer science android java gnu make throughput recitation html ubuntu workflows infrastructure automation jenkins mpls vpn python eclipse scripting gitlab code review linux software development life cycle solution design software quality management tkinter experimentation troubleshooting algorithms business logic amx programming sqlite agile methodology integration version control jira servicenow json numpy kubernetes docker application development ansible back-end operations software development javascript data quality